My Life As an Explorer (Amundsen) by Roald Amundsen

This autobiography tells the story of a Norwegian explorer who led the first expeditions to reach the South Pole, traverse the Northwest Passage, and fly over the North Pole in a dirigible. The book provides a detailed account of his adventures, including his experiences with the indigenous peoples of the Arctic, his struggles with harsh weather conditions, and his insights on leadership and survival in extreme environments. The author's love for exploration and his respect for the natural world shine through in his writing.
